What Bullet And Weight Are You Using To Make Major In .38 Super?


PistolPete

Recommended Posts

I'm curious what bullet weight and style people are using to make Major for IPSC in a race gun. I'm going to be buying a new race gun and am trying to figure what combination of components I'll also be needing. What bullet brand are you using also?

115 grain CMJ from Montana Gold Bullets

I used to use 124's, but wanted more gas pressure to work the ports and comp better. They were 124gr. CMJ's again from MGB. I'll be trying their 121gr. bullets when I get back home. BTW, the pistol shoots .5" at 50 yards. Gotta love Rusty Kidd.

I use a 115 zero HP in front of 9.4 of 3n37. I'm not flashing on a lead base and at 170pf I'm getting good accuracy and almost no flip from my Schuemann hybrid + 6 port comp. I load a Smirfel long (RCH is inappropriate with ladys present). They just feed better.

precision delta 124 .356 bullets.

fed 200 primers

starline or armscor brass

7.5 grains imr 7625

loaded to 1.250

makes 171 in 1-32 twist 4 port hybrid...not nearly as LOUD as some of the other popular loads.

Alliant power pistol shoots good too. its just incredibly LOUD!

I guess I'm kind of weird. I like a heavier bullet. 135 gr Zero RN sized .356".

Currently burning SR 4756, 8.2 gr making 1275 fps.

Winchester Small Pistol Primers

Currently 38 super mixed brass
